3. Operating Instructions
3.1. Preparation for Use
Remove the instrument from the shipping container and check for any physical damage. In
the case of damage, report it immediately to MGP Instruments.
Do not attempt to install or operate damaged equipment since safety and performance may
be affected
3.2. Starting-up
Ensure that the detector is connected to the meter. Press the ON/OFF push-button. For pre-
1999 models, when the meter is turned on, it carries out a short self-test procedure indicated
by displaying all the segments on the display and emitting two beeps for a short period.
Following the test, the meter is ready for use. For 1999-present models, when the meter is
turned on, it emits a single beep, then followed by three shorts beeps indicating the self-test
procedure is completed and the meter is ready for use.
Note: When the meter is turned on, the low range GM Tube is not connected. As a safeguard,
the high-range GM Tube is connected (>600 mR/hr) in the event that the user is in a high
exposure rate field. If the radiation field measurement is lower than 600 mR/h, the meter
switches to the low range GM Tube.
3.3. General Functions
3.3.1. Exposure rate Display
The TelePole measures Exposure rates in the range of 0.0 1mR/h to 999 R/h.
Readings are displayed in digital and analog mode. The ranges in the bar graph are changed
automatically and the units displayed correspond to both, the digital and analog display. The
bar graph measuring response is quicker than the digital display response since the latter
averages the readings.
3.3.2. Automatic Range Switching:
The detector includes two Geiger: Low range - ZP-1201 (or equivalent), and high range -
ZP-1301 (or equivalent).
In a field of 0.01 mR/h to 800 mR/h both geigers are connected and the field is measured by
the low range geiger. In case the radiation field is higher than 800 mR/h (Optional Firmware
‘070301’ 2500 mR/h), the low range geiger is disconnected, and the radiation field is
measured by the high range Geiger. The switching between the low and high range geigers
is done at 800 mR/h when the radiation field increases (low range geiger is disconnected),
and at 600 mR/h (Optional Firmware 2000 mR/h) when the radiation field decreases (low
range geiger is connected).
